About Book

Step into the world of literature with Walking through the Forest, an engaging anthology featuring over 80 insightful book reviews penned by Muhammad Omar Iftikhar. Originally published in Pakistani media from 2015 to 2024, these reviews offer a literary exploration into the works of authors hailing from Pakistan and beyond. About Author

Muhammad Omar Iftikhar is a fiction writer and columnist with a portfolio of over 1,000 published articles in various English-language publications in Pakistan. His writing journey began on July 10, 2004, with the publication of his first article in Young World, a prominent weekly publication of Daily Dawn. His expertise spans an array of subjects, including communication, sports, society, current affairs, geopolitical activities, social issues, personality development, science and technology, literature, and book reviews. In December 2020, Omar achieved a significant milestone by publishing his debut novel, ;Divided Species (Auraq, 2020). This science fiction story made him the first Pakistani author to write a science fiction story set in Karachi. He is also the author of “20 Steps to Writing” (Daastan, 2022) that discusses strategies to develop effective writing skills. Omar has previously served as a Strategy and Planning Executive at Symmetry Group, a digital media advertising agency. He also served as the Assistant Editor of Slogan Magazine and South Asia Magazine. Currently, he serves as Assistant Manager, Public Relations at the Marketing and Communications Department at the Institute of Business Management (IoBM), Karachi. IoBM is also his alma mater.
